Raymond Anderson Obituary
Anderson, Raymond Clarence “Ray” –
Passed away peacefully in his 93rd year, after a short illness, on Friday, January 5, 2024 at the Credit Valley Hospital, Mississauga, with his family by his side. Son of the late Clarence and Eldred Anderson, Ray was born on the family farm in Terra Cotta. Ray was the beloved husband of Norma for 63 years and the loving father of Susan and David (Brian). Beloved brother of the late Don (Marlene), sister of Betty Jean Carberry (Clare), and brother of David (Joyce). Dear uncle of Caron (Mark), Kevin (Michelle), Janet, Glenn, Brad (Annalee), Bob and Julie. Ray completed his B.Sc. in Pharmacy at U of T in 1959 and was a pharmacist for 38 years serving in Brampton, Georgetown and Milton. He enjoyed the cottage, music, theatre, travelling and being a handyman “Mr. Fix It”. Ray will be forever remembered by his family for his caring, positive and even-tempered personality and his wonderful sense of humor.
Friends and family will be received at the Jones Funeral Home, 11582 Trafalgar Road, Georgetown on Wednesday, January 10th from 2-4 and 6-8 p.m. Funeral service will be held in the chapel on Thursday, January 11th at 11 a.m. Reception to follow in the Trafalgar Room. Interment at Hillcrest Cemetery, Norval.
Memorial contributions to the Heart & Stroke Foundation, or the charity of your choice in lieu of flowers, would be appreciated.
